A hostile takeover takes place when a company acquires another company by direct interaction with the shareholders or by making an attempt to replace the management of the company in order to take over it. The takeover bidding takes place when the acquirer makes efforts to take control of the target company without any prior approval or discussion with the Board of Directors of the target company.

Sections 25 and 35 of the Insolvency and Bankruptcy Code, 2016 (Code) enumerate the duties of a Resolution Professional (RP) and a Liquidator, respectively. These duties include certain actions in respect of avoidance transactions (preferential transactions, undervalued transactions, extortionate transactions, and fraudulent trading).

NCLAT declined to accept the stand of the Financial Creditor that, Article 62 of the Limitation Act, will be applicable for counting limitation under Section 7 of the IBC and further held that only Article 137 of the Limitation will be applicable on the Application under Section 7, 9 and 10 of the IBC.
MCA Amends Section 4 of Insolvency and Bankruptcy Code, 2016 to increase Threshold of default to Rs 1 crore. Section 4 deals with defaults relating to the insolvency and liquidation of corporate debtors. Section 4 is been amended vide S.O. 1205(E) Dated 24th March, 2020. Revised Threshold is applicable from 24.03.2020.
